(Reuters) - The all-stock merger of CBS Corp and Viacom Inc is expected to close on Dec. 4, the companies said on Monday.Shares of the combined company, which would be renamed as ViacomCBS Inc, are expected to start trading on Nasdaq from Dec.5 under the new ticker symbols "VIACA" and "VIAC", the companies said.Earlier in August, CBS and Viacom agreed to merge, creating a company with more than $28 billion (21.7 billion pounds) in revenue, as an increasingly competitive media landscape..
